Botox may smooth wrinkles, but it works by temporarily paralyzing muscles using a neurotoxin.
Before you book your next appointment, here are a few things to consider:
• Repeated use can lead to muscle atrophy over time
• Facial muscles play a role in circulation and lymphatic drainage
• Some women experience headaches, eyelid drooping, facial asymmetry, or a “frozen” appearance
• Neighboring muscles may compensate, creating new movement patterns and lines
• Botox doesn’t address the real drivers of accelerated aging: inflammation, poor sleep, hormone imbalances, blood sugar dysregulation, nutrient deficiencies, chronic stress, and excessive sun exposure
A smoother forehead doesn’t always equal healthier aging.
